Paedophile former priest handed another sentence for assaulting boy
Alexander Bede Walsh was already serving a 22 year prison sentence
An already jailed former Roman Catholic priest has been given another sentence after sexually assaulting a boy at a church in Cheadle, Staffordshire.
72-year-old Alexander Bede Walsh has been sentenced to one year in prison after being convicted of indecent assault against a child.
He is currently serving a 22 year prison sentence which started in 2012.
He was previously convicted of two sexual offences and 19 counts of indecent assault.
Archbishop Bernard Longley, from the Archdiocese of Birmingham, said: “It is extremely distressing to hear of a further victim/survivor of Bede Walsh.
"As at the time of the initial trial in 2012, I offer once again my sincere apologies and wish to express my profound regret to all those have been affected."
